Captured on Kodak T-max 100 with a Rolleicord Va.

Overdeveloped by half a stop in Ars-imago FD developer.

Scanned using a digital camera and contrast adjust in LR.

It was a really windy day and I wanted to catch the the way the trees move, but how do you catch the wind? I reduced my shutter speed right down and so realised after I had caught the wave of the air moving, it looks like a bit of an oil painting but I like it.

I didn't put too much effort in taking photos of this total lunar eclipse. Instead I just enjoyed the event through the eyepiece of my 8" Reflector.

I have to say this event was quite a revelation and no Image can really capture the sheer beauty of it.

So in between I just took my phone and captured this image through the eyepiece as a souvenir.
